1966 Chiefs 27 - 1963 Giants 24




The Chiefs were able to hold off the magnificent Y.A. Tittle and the 63 Giants on the strength of three timely interceptions and a 91 yard punt return by Mike Garrett. The Giants could muster almost no running game against Stram's defense, but Tittle threw for over 400 yards as the Giants kept battling back.

One feature of old time teams is that most of them them force turnovers at a hair-raising rate compered to modern teams - and tend to be sloppy with ball security. A lot of this is because the passing game is much more geared towards long passing. Even so, this excellent Giants team is less prone than most of the era to turn it over - but the Chiefs are ball hawks extraordinaire, and they got enough to win the game.

1959 Giants 13 - 1057 Lions 10




I have been playing this game for 40 years in the original and PC versions. I have never. NEVER. Made as stupid a decision as I did coaching the Lions in this old school slugfest.

Lions are up, 10 - 3, and at the Giants 5 yard line in the fourth. Bobby Layne has been hurt, crippling the Lions offense as Tebowish running QB Tobin Rote is now at the helm. Hopalong Cassady loses a fumble on third down. Terrible. The Lions could have essentially salted away the game on the next play with a FG. Ah well, thems the breaks.

Giants move out of the shadow of their goal posts with a 15 yard Conerly pass and a ten yard run. On the next play though Conerly is sacked for 12, followed by a holding penalty on the Giants, followed by a loss on a draw play. Its now 3rd and over 30. Conerly is hit again and fumbles and the Lions recover at the four - dialog box opens - Fall on the Ball, or pick up and run?

And the idiot coaching the Lions sez pick up the ball. Lions fumble, Giants recover...and its First and Ten Giants! the Giants drive the field to tie. All I had to do was fall on the ball, run some clock, kick a FG for a 2 score lead, that should have been it.

Next drive Tobin Rote strings a few completions and a couple of good scrambles together to get in FG range, but the Lions miss on @ a 75% shot. Giatns QB Conerly hits a long pass on the next play, Giants are in FG position, and Pat Summerall wins the damned thing. The end.

I really enjoyed playing these Lions, but they were overmatched and a touch unlucky this time. Giants are on to the Third Round
